I also have a Country Coach, 1995 conversion. The salon AC was having a cycling issue and
resulted in a damaged AC compressor. My
issue was the suction pressure was so low, it was causing the compressor to
cycle on/off. It appears my issue is the
suction hoses(restriction in AC lines) are crimped/pinched where they go through the coach floor. This has been a long term problem. I am replacing them now, what a PIB!
Additionally, I have installed pressure controls on the
condenser fans, cycling the condenser fans on/off with discharge pressure
swings. During the winter or moderate
temperature, with the condenser fans running all the time, the evaporators
would freeze up. Now the condenser fans
are off during this time.
It is not surprising
that Prevost will not repair the CC salon air. It is a complicated system and does not meet
the criteria of Prevost. It will take
time to sort out issues that do not fall into the “replace components” category.
At times, real troubleshooting is
required, meaning a firm knowledge of AC systems is required. I also tried the Prevost repair of the CC AC, no success.
Be sure and check for leaks.
The hose ends on mine needed to be recrimped to make a leak free system.
